Vitalie Vremis

Deputy Resident Representative at UNDP

Vitalie Vremis has extensive experience in international development and public administration, currently serving as the Deputy Resident Representative at the United Nations Development Programme (UNDP) since November 2014. Prior to this role, Vitalie held the position of Portfolio Manager at the United Nations Development Programme from 2004 to February 2012 and served as the Executive Director of the Educational Advising Center between January 1999 and February 2004. Vitalie Vremis obtained a Master's degree in Public Administration from Academia de Administrare Publica in 2007 and a Bachelor's degree in Economics from Academia de Studii Economice din Moldova in 1999.
